The Dambulla Cave Temple: A Glimpse into Ancient Art
Your first stop is the Dambulla Cave Temple, a UNESCO World Heritage Site famed for its stunning Buddha statues and vibrant cave paintings. Located about 148 kilometers east of Colombo, this site is a visual feast of ancient artistry. Expect around an hour here, giving you enough time to appreciate the intricate murals and the golden Buddha statues that adorn the caves.
Travelers frequently comment on the serene atmosphere and impressive craftsmanship. One review highlights, “The cave paintings are breathtaking, and the statues are so detailed—you really feel like stepping back in time.” The site’s elevated position also offers sweeping views of the surrounding landscape, adding a sense of peaceful grandeur.
Sigiriya Rock Fortress: An Architectural Marvel
Next, you’ll head to Sigiriya, often called the “Lion Rock,” towering at 600 feet. Built over 1,600 years ago, this ancient fortress is celebrated for its beautiful frescoes, impressive gardens, and panoramic views from the top. The climb involves some steps, but the reward is worth it—imagine standing atop the rock and soaking in the vistas of lush greenery stretching for miles.
Many reviewers praise the well-preserved ruins and the artistry of the frescoes, with one noting, “The views from the top are spectacular, and the site’s history is fascinating.” Expect about two hours here, giving enough time to explore the ruins, snap photos, and learn about its storied past.

Minneriya National Park: Elephants in the Wild
The final leg of the tour is the wildlife safari at Minneriya National Park, famous for the largest gathering of wild elephants in the world. Depending on the season, the safari might be at Minneriya, Kaudulla, or Hurulu Eco Park, but all promise a chance to see elephants and other wildlife in their natural environment.
The safari lasts about three hours and is the highlight for many. While the price of park admission isn’t included, the experience of spotting herds of elephants, sometimes numbering in the hundreds, is unforgettable. One reviewer expressed excitement, saying, “Seeing so many elephants in one place is surreal—I felt like I was in a wildlife documentary.”
